Product reviews:
Goddard
2024-11-26 iphone 7 Plus
50cm Komodo Dragon Plush by RIN001 large komodo dragon stuffed animal
large komodo dragon stuffed animal
Pin on For Devon large komodo dragon stuffed animal
large komodo dragon stuffed animal
17 Inch Stuffed Animal Plush Monitor large komodo dragon stuffed animal
large komodo dragon stuffed animal